Secondary Rack Electrical Connections
Each rack is supplied with 24V power via a 6-pin 7/8-Mini cable and communication via a yellow Cat5e ethernet cable shown in Figure 31 and Figure 32. The required cable part numbers correspond to the rack position as provided in Table 4.
Figure 31: Yellow 7/8-Mini Power Cable to Secondary Racks (Actual Cable Includes 6 Pins)
Figure 32: Yellow Cat5e Communication Cable to Secondary Racks
Table 4: Secondary Rack Connection Cable Part Numbers
| Connection from Rack 1 to: | 7/8-Mini Cable PN | Cat5e Cable PN |
|---|---|---|
| Rack 2 | 101946 (12ft) | 101893 (12ft) |
| Rack 3 | 101947 (20ft) | 101196 (25ft) |
| Rack 4 | 102283 (50ft) | 102282 (50ft) |
| Rack 5 | 102283 (50ft) | 102282 (50ft) |
The 7/8-Mini and Cat5e cables originate from the bottom of the main low voltage box and the Rack 1 network switch as shown in Figure 33 and terminate on each racks’ low voltage plate as shown in Figure 34.
